Renewable Energy Solutions

The transition towards clean energy is one of the most effective methods to address climate change and reduce overall warming. Photovoltaic power, wind energy, and hydroelectric systems are leading this effort, providing greener alternatives to non-renewable energy sources. These resources harness natural phenomena, changing sunlight, wind, and moving water into usable energy, which significantly reduces carbon emissions. Photovoltaic energy, in particular, has seen impressive growth in the last years. Photovoltaic panels are becoming more efficient, and advancements such as solar shingles and integrated photovoltaics offer versatile solutions for energy generation in city settings. Homeowners and businesses opting for solar power not only contribute to curtailing carbon footprints but also often see cut energy bills and greater property value. Public incentives and lowering equipment costs further encourage this transition, demonstrating the possibility for solar energy to play a crucial role in reducing climate change.

Wind energy is a further key player in the sustainable landscape. Wind energy farms, including onshore and offshore, have appeared as major sources of electricity in many regions. Utilizing modern turbine technology, these installations capture wind energy efficiently, generating power that is renewable and sustainable. The expansion of wind energy not only contributes in cutting down carbon emissions but also provides job opportunities in production, setup, and service. As investments in wind technology continue to expand, this sustainable source is poised to make a big impact to global energy needs while addressing the pressing challenges of climate change.

Carbon Capture Technologies

Carbon capture methods are growing increasingly vital in the battle against global warming and rising temperatures. These innovative systems function by trapping CO2 emissions from various sources, such as power plants and industrial processes, before they can pollute the atmosphere. By halting this greenhouse gas from adding to global warming, carbon capture can serve a key role in meeting global climate goals.

One of the most popular methods for sequestration involves extraction from the air, where sophisticated machinery extracts CO2 directly from the air. This approach can be particularly impactful in countries aiming to reduce their carbon emissions substantially. Additionally, carbon capture can be integrated with renewable energy generation, creating a closed-loop system that not only produces energy but also removes CO2 from the atmosphere. This synergy enhances the overall efficiency of both energy production and emission reduction.

The sequestered carbon dioxide can then be stored underground in subsurface formations or repurposed for multiple applications, such as manufacturing synthetic fuels or construction supplies. These advancements not only provide a means to mitigate carbon emissions but also pave the way for a circular economy. As carbon capture technologies continue to develop and expand, they hold the potential to significantly reduce the effects of climate change and help create a more sustainable future.

Eco-Friendly Practices in Agriculture

Eco-Friendly methods in farming play a crucial role in combating climate change and lessening global warming. By emphasizing approaches that boost soil health, save water, and lower the reliance on chemical fertilizers, farmers can minimize carbon emissions associated with standard agriculture. Techniques such as crop rotation and forest farming not only improve biodiversity but also enhance the robustness of farming systems against the effects of climate change.

One innovative approach is the implementation of technological farming, which makes use of modern tools to streamline site-specific operation regarding crop farming. By employing sensors, global positioning systems, and data analysis, farmers can make smart judgments that significantly lessen losses and resource use. This approach also enables in monitoring greenhouse gas emissions closely, allowing for targeted strategies that further reduce eco-friendly consequences.

Moreover, the adoption of organic farming and sustainable agriculture principles offers an different pathway to conventional agriculture. These approaches encourage the use of natural inputs and promote environmental balance, which can store carbon dioxide in the ground. By adopting these green practices, the agricultural sector can aid to a better planet and combat the growing challenges posed by global warming.
